Saint-André-d’Olérargues
Saint-André-d’Olérargues is a locality in Arrondissement of Nîmes, Gard, Occitanie. Saint-André-d’Olérargues is situated nearby to the village Saint-Marcel-de-Careiret, as well as near the locality Collongres.| Tap on a place to explore it |

La Roque-sur-Cèze
Village
Photo: SombreSanglier, CC BY 4.0.
La Roque-sur-Cèze is a commune in the Gard department in the Occitanie region of Southern France. It is a member of Les Plus Beaux Villages de France Association. La Roque-sur-Cèze is situated 4½ km northeast of Saint-André-d’Olérargues.
